How to Care for Your Invisalign Retainers

You’re thrilled at the prospect at finally having straight teeth and a great smile with Invisalign aligners. But you must be careful to take good care of your retainers. Here are five tips to protect them.

Clean your Invisalign retainers daily. They will collect food, bacteria and plaque, so it’s important to rinse them several times every day. Lukewarm water will remove any bacteria build-up. And soaking your retainer weekly in distilled water (with a drop of castile soap or baking soda) will disinfect the retainer. After soaking, gently clean the retainer with your toothbrush, then rinse it with lukewarm water. Never use boiling water or chemicals on your retainer.

Protect your retainer from extreme heat. Because your retainers are plastic, it makes sense that extreme heat will distort their shape. Always use lukewarm water to protect the retainer. If you accidentally leave your retainer in extreme heat, contact your dentist right away. You may need a replacement.

Don’t soak in mouthwash. Mouthwash has a pigment that your plastic retainer will absorb and can give your teeth an unwanted colour.

Clean retainers before storing them in their case. When you’re moving on to another set of retainers, it’s best to store them carefully — just in case you need them again later.

Remove your retainer when drinking any beverages. Keep your case with you so you can store it quickly when necessary.

Follow your orthodontist’s instructions and stay committed to keeping your retainers clean and maintaining good dental health.
